More about the book

The story explores themes of power and injustice through the encounter between a Wolf and a Lamb. The Wolf, seeking to justify his predatory instincts, fabricates reasons to accuse the innocent Lamb of wrongdoing. Despite the Lamb's logical refutations, the Wolf ultimately succumbs to his nature and devours him. This fable illustrates how those in positions of power often manipulate the truth to rationalize their actions, highlighting the persistent nature of tyranny in society.
